I'm from north India, from U.P (now from Delhi I must say). Raksha Bandhan is a festival of love , no matter how much we fight with our brothers whole year on small small things , but today is one day we care for each others likeness.
Mithe Jave is one essential thing we cook on raksha bandhan. Jave is a kind of a small vermicelli. During in months of july and august (before Raksha bandhan) u can see mothers and grand mothers making jave all evening by hand for rakhi.

Mithe Jave
Ingds-
1 Cup Jave (roasted)
2 1/2 cups of Milk
1/2 cup Sugar
1/2 tsp Cardamom Pd
Kishmish, almonds, pistachios
Few strands Saffron
Coconut (shredded) for garnishing
Boil milk and add Jave in the milk with cardamom pd,kishmish, saffron and sugar. Continue to boil on low heat until it becomes thick and jave are all cooked. Garnish with almonds, pistachios and coconut.
Serve hot or cold but with lots of love.....
(Jave absorbs milk when cool so make sure to have enough milk left when u switch off the gas)
